Trend | Description |
---|---|
Sustainability | Hotels are increasingly incorporating eco-friendly practices and materials in their design to reduce environmental impact. |
Technology Integration | Smart rooms, keyless entry, and interactive features are becoming standard in modern hotel designs. |
Local Influence | Hotels are embracing local culture and heritage in their architecture and decor to provide an authentic experience for guests. |
Wellness Focus | Spa facilities, fitness centers, and healthy dining options are prioritized in hotel designs to cater to wellness-conscious travelers. |
